    Gunsmithing Our latest barrel fluting effort.

    By starting with such a large diameter blank and removing material so deep while leaving the structural web at a large diameter you maximize your stiffness to weight ratio. Most fluting I consider more for looks than function but this one removes a lot of weight while keeping it stiff. --Jerry

    Gunsmithing tool holders

    You need 3 or 4 different sizes of boring bars, a good threading setup, a profiling tool or 2, and roughing tools. CNMG makes a good rougher V-shaped inserts are good for profiling. Lost of different threading options and all are good. Solid carbide is superior for boring bars but expensive in...

    Help. 6.5 Creedmoor loads showing pressure signs??

    Cratering is caused by a firing pin hole on the order of .080". Contrary to some belief, it isn't a loose fitting firing pin. When a modern high pressure round goes off, the pressure extrudes the brass from the primer into the firing pin hole. It just pushes the firing pin up out of the way...

    Gunsmithing Action screw torque

    How did you check? the only way to check is to mark the heads of the screws, back them off, and then increase torque until you get them to the same place. Torque required to loosen is meaningless.
